    Buyer’s Guide: Selecting the Best Cat Litter Box

    Buying a cat litter box is essential for cat owners. However, it pays to take the time to consider its potential features and designs because you’re going to be doing the cleaning. You need to think about how easy that is and how the box is constructed to minimize the waste outside of it. After all, cat paws are like litter magnets, spreading the particles outside of their container. All the cat litter boxes reviewed fall into one of the three categories below.

    The features to consider include:
    • Open or covered
    • Size and entry opening
    • Self-cleaning

    Open Litter Box or Covered Litter Box

    It’s an ongoing debate with cat owners. On the surface, it seems like a covered litter box is a way to go. The litter stays inside of it, and it’s aesthetically pleasing, given its function. However, there’s more to it than these basic things.

    First and perhaps foremost, it’s a matter of whether your cat will use it. Felines like covered places, which can stir their natural curiosity. Contrary to popular belief, cats care little about privacy. Second, there is odor control. The smell may not seem obvious — unless you’re inside of it. That makes a charcoal filter imperative. Many pets will avoid using a stinky box.

    Self-cleaning, covered boxes are an evident solution. The mechanism will contain the mess for you and your pet. However, it you must also think about cleaning it. You still need easy access to it, and you must replace the litter regularly. It’ll help if that’s easier to do than having to disassemble and reassemble the box.

    Size and Entry Openings

    Size is a vital consideration if you have a larger cat or more than one in your household. You need to consider the overall dimensions and the height of the opening. It’s a balancing act. You want it high enough to keep the litter inside, without making it too difficult for your pet to enter and exit it. That also applies to the height if you go with a covered box. Some manufacturers solve this problem with ramps.

    Self-Cleaning Cat Litter Boxes

    A self-cleaning litter box seems like a first-world solution. But that belies the fact that dirty litter represents a health issue. This type of box is a helpful innovation when you consider it in that light. Bear in mind that it often means proprietary replacement products, whether they’re trays, cartridges, or other items. That adds to the financial and environmental cost of these products.

    An open litter box is a viable option that offers many benefits. These boxes are easy to clean. You can use whatever liners, litters, or cleaning items that you want. That can make them a more affordable option in the long run. The tradeoff is that you may have closer contact with dirty litter. It’s a decision that you’ll need to weigh.
